Wigwam

Break the ice by getting competitive at one of Dublin's top activity bars, Wigwam. Pair tropical cocktails, from a mai tai to the classic piña colada, with ping pong, tiki bingo, karaoke and comedy nights. There's also a range of food options if all the fun sees you work up an appetite – think homemade pizzas, loaded fries and vegan burgers. 

Disndat

Disndat is a live music pub in the heart of Dublin, providing locals with a place to gather for laid-back pints, cocktails and toasties among friends. With musicians entertaining the crowds every night of the week and a drinks menu that includes tiramisu martinis and a Snickers old fashioned, there's no reason not to visit this buzzing haunt. 

Proof

Proof is a trendy pizzeria and cocktail bar in The Liberties, offering a relaxed approach to first dates in Dublin. The bar's cocktail wall offers a plethora of mixes on draft, from Aperol spritz, espresso martini and old fashioned. Felling peckish? Try out the menu of Romano-style crispy pizzas.

Sophie's

Sophie's is definitely one swish rooftop bar for a date in Dublin. With ample list of cocktails alongside a curated selection of gin and alcohol-free options, the place is a great all-rounder with a lovely suntrap terrace for alfresco outings in the warmer months. 

Ohana

Ohana offers a sense of paradise from its home in Portobello, serving up some of the finest rum creations in the city within its colourful interiors. A gorgeous date night idea in Dublin, the venue is not only beautiful to look at but its cocktail menu is really something special.

Opium

Opium really does do it all; fronting a cocktail bar, swish restaurant, roof terrace and club all under one roof. One of Dublin's hottest tickets for a night out, its sure to impress that special someone with an evening full of eating, drinking and dancing, all in an undeniably cool location.

Isabelle's

One of the city's most elegant eateries and bars, Isabelle's is a stunning choice for that all-important first meeting. With its stylish decor, impressive food offering and curated list of expertly blended cocktails, this bar is sure to make your date swoon. 

Bison Bar

Bison Bar combines hearty grub off the grill with the largest selection of whiskies in Ireland, making for one quirky date night location. Head over to this American-inspired gem and dive into the menu of mouthwatering smoked meat paired with impressive signature sips.
